我有一个带有dll的.Net应用程序,其中一些是用.Net 1.1编译的,有些是用2.0编译的。这样的应用程序如何工作 - 应用程序是否只有一个运行时?如果是这样的话呢?如果不是如何在运行时之间传递对象?

有帮助吗?

解决方案

你说的是,应用程序中只使用了一个运行时。在您的情况下,整个应用程序需要使用2.0运行时:1.1运行时无法理解2.0 DLL,但2.0运行时确实知道1.1 DLL。

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top